Overall Meaning

The song "Dogs" by Moist presents a story about a man who is going through a hard time and decides to leave his current situation behind in search of a better future with the woman he loves. He packs his lunch and steals his boss's car before heading out on a long journey from his hometown to California, where he knows the woman he loves is waiting. As he drives down the freeway, passing groves on the way, he sings about how she picks him up like nothing he's ever experienced before, giving him a new perspective on life. Despite the dogs at the door, which could be a metaphor for the problems he's facing holding him back, he's determined to make a better life for himself. The song presents a sense of hope and determination, an optimistic outlook on what's to come.
